Dirt road leveling services involve the careful grading and reshaping of unpaved or poorly maintained dirt roads and driveways. This process typically uses specialized equipment to redistribute soil and fill in uneven areas, creating a more stable and even surface. Proper leveling helps improve drainage, prevent erosion, and reduce the accumulation of mud or ruts, making the road safer and more functional for everyday use. Homeowners with rural properties, farms, or properties that rely on unpaved access routes often seek these services to enhance the usability and appearance of their driveways and access roads.
Many property owners turn to dirt road leveling to address common problems such as washouts, potholes, and uneven terrain that develop over time. These issues can make driving difficult, cause damage to vehicles, or lead to muddy conditions after rain. By leveling the dirt surface, service providers help create a smoother, more predictable surface that minimizes these issues. This is especially important for properties that experience frequent weather changes or heavy traffic, as maintaining an even surface can significantly reduce ongoing maintenance needs and improve overall property value.

The overview below groups typical Dirt Road Leveling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Spring Hill, TN.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or dirt road leveling in Spring Hill, TN, range from $250 to $600 for many routine jobs. Most small projects fall within this band, covering simple grading or patching work. Larger, more complex repairs tend to exceed this range.
Standard Projects - Medium-sized leveling jobs often cost between $600 and $1,500. Many local contractors handle these projects regularly, which include smoothing out moderate unevenness or minor drainage issues. Projects pushing into higher costs are less common.
Large-Scale Work - Extensive dirt road leveling or significant grading projects typically fall between $1,500 and $3,500. These jobs often involve substantial earthmoving and can vary based on terrain complexity. Fewer projects reach into this higher range.
Full Replacement or Complex Projects - Larger, more detailed dirt road leveling or complete resurfacing projects can reach $5,000 or more. Such jobs are less frequent and usually involve substantial site preparation, drainage improvements, or extensive earthwork. Local service providers can assess specific project needs for accurate estimates.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is dirt road leveling? Dirt road leveling involves smoothing and adjusting uneven surfaces to create a stable, even roadway suitable for vehicle travel.
How do local contractors perform dirt road leveling? They typically use specialized equipment to grade and compact the dirt, ensuring proper drainage and a level surface.
What are common reasons to consider dirt road leveling? It can improve accessibility, reduce dust, prevent erosion, and extend the lifespan of the road.
Can dirt road leveling be done on existing roads? Yes, it is often performed on existing dirt roads to restore or improve their condition.
